Hi guys,

Im new here and tried looking for an answer but can't find it.
Can anyone explain to me what is happening:

I have made a BTC withdraw from Cryptsy about 16 hours ago, but I still havent received my BTC in my wallet.
I have had contact with Cryptsy and they are saying that the coins have been send and processed. So can anyone tell me where they are now?

Is it normal for a withdraw to take so long?

T.I.A.

mate but the wallet address that you have posted above has received the btc.
The transaction already has 113 confirmations.

https://blockchain.info/address/1HpVQzKgMouUUgnuCab9jt3xrsXho5iDpR

Possibilities that i can think of is either you gave the btc address wrong to cryptsy or your wallet is not synced with the network.

I have reloaded the blockchain and now its showing.

I didnt know you can easily reload the chain within Multibit.

Thanks for the effort!
